Yes, Ibuprofen can be taken to relieve moderate pain and inflammation but I still need some more information to advise you better.
As per your complain it seems that you have a deep cavity in your tooth that has involved the nerves present in the central portion of the tooth and irritation of nerves is causing pain. You are taking Acemiz Plus that is a combination of Acelofenac and Acetaminophen and are capable of reducing mild to moderate pain condition..

I would like to tell you that as you have taken 250 mg amoxicillin, it is a lesser dose for an adult and you should take 500mg amoxicillin.
Other thing is that you can take Ibuprofen but it will also not be able to completely relieve severe pain and to control severe pain you can take Tramadol which is a Narcotic painkiller and is capable of reducing heavy pain also..
But as it is narcotic painkiller it should be taken only for a short duration as it can cause addiction if taken for long..
So better take it for 5 days only..
Another thing that I would like to tell you is that as you have a deep infection in your tooth it will be better to consult a Dentist and get evaluated and also
he /she may advise you to get an IOPAR [x ray] of the tooth done..
If the tooth is in the condition to be saved Root canal treatment can help in relieving pain permanently..
In case if the tooth is extensively decayed extraction can provide relief..
As the medicines can only provide you temporary relief you can take medicine for 5 days and within this duration get your tooth treated for permanent relief..
